Transaction 59cf2f7606e5a68619af3302fef20887a390c742a370b5ef4e73c0ea29d52a97

1 Input
2 Outputs
  • 59cf2f7606e5a68619af3302fef20887a390c742a370b5ef4e73c0ea29d52a97:0
  • value  366492
    address  36FrWVBf4TNXyvUmAB6w3WSXzthwHgdme2
  • 59cf2f7606e5a68619af3302fef20887a390c742a370b5ef4e73c0ea29d52a97:1
  • value  23966915
    address  1PNjnv1cGGxS4jA86F81CAX85j7Y6C3gBT